# SigNoz

[<mark style="color:blue;">SigNoz</mark>](https://signoz.io/) is an open source Datadog or New Relic alternative. A single tool for all your observability needs - APM, logs, metrics, exceptions, alerts, and dashboards powered by a powerful query builder.

Route alerts from SigNoz to the right users in Squadcast.

### Using SigNoz as an Alert Source

1. Navigate to **Services** -> **Service Overview** -> select or search for your Service. Expand the accordion -> In the Alert Sources section, click **Add**.

![](https://1574591692-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8TaWz01jmUJl58p4ZVel%2Fuploads%2Fgit-blob-0fe7b657e32aa4dc525b39230eeb6f7628304674%2FScreenshot%202022-07-29%20at%2012.09.33%20PM%20\(1\)%20\(1\).png?alt=media\&token=a31a38c5-13c7-4109-a22c-ffb44c420b19)

2. Select **SigNoz.** Copy the displayed **Webhook URL** to [configure](#create-a-squadcast-webhook-alert-in-signoz) it within **SigNoz.** Finish by clicking **Add Alert Source** -> **Done.**

![](https://1574591692-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8TaWz01jmUJl58p4ZVel%2Fuploads%2Fgit-blob-da954ca0551eed175be0817dfecab184180ca710%2Fsignoz_1.png?alt=media\&token=7b54f4f4-6396-4f77-8b21-e8e9611a6a6b)

{% hint style="warning" %} <mark style="color:orange;">**Important**</mark>**:**

When an alert source turns <mark style="color:green;">Active</mark>, it’ll show up under Configured Alert Sources. You can either generate a test alert from the integration or wait for a real-time alert to be generated by the Alert Source.\
\
An Alert Source is <mark style="color:green;">active</mark> if there is a recorded incident via that Alert Source for the Service.
{% endhint %}

### Create a Squadcast Webhook Alert in SigNoz

**(1)** Login to your **SigNoz** dashboard and navigate to **Settings** section. Under the **Settings** section, go to **Alert Channels** and click on **+ New Alert Channel**

![](https://1574591692-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8TaWz01jmUJl58p4ZVel%2Fuploads%2Fgit-blob-8abd13bad63b76b4b7a799fd41f375e967280d39%2Fsignoz_2.png?alt=media\&token=3da97333-9423-4aa2-b004-75bf3515ea9e)

**(2)** Fill in the **Name**, select **Type** as **Webhook** and paste the previously copied Squadcast Webhook URL in the placeholder for **Webhook URL**. Then click on **Save**

Users can also click on **Test** to test the integration.

![](https://1574591692-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2F8TaWz01jmUJl58p4ZVel%2Fuploads%2Fgit-blob-7391cc9b216ac23ac580b91504003f32751b0159%2Fsignoz_3.png?alt=media\&token=897882a8-aafa-42c7-9ce5-4c84826fa561)

That's it, you are good to go! Your SigNoz integration is now complete.

Whenever SigNoz fires an alert, an incident will be created in Squadcast for it. Once the tool sends a **resolved** alert, it will automatically be resolved in Squadcast as well.

*Have any questions?* [*Ask the community*](https://community.squadcast.com/view/home)*.*
